Net Worth Breakdown
If you just check out the India Rich List 2026, Narayana Murthy is estimated to have a net worth of about $4 billion. Most of this wealth originates from the Infosys shares he still holds. Hence, the value of his net worth changes with every fluctuation in the Infosys stock price. One major point to highlight here is that Infosys has always been one of the leading IT companies in India and continues to pay good dividends. This is a major factor behind the strength of his wealth. According to 2025 shareholding data, he owns approximately 0.41 percent stake in Infosys which translates to roughly 1,51,45,638 shares.
Income Sources Explained
You know like, sure, contrary to the majority of people, Narayana Murthy does not necessarily depend on a regular monthly pay for his earnings. Most of his money actually comes from the shares of Infosys that he is holding. For instance, according to the reports of 2025, a single dividend distribution from Infosys can fetch him approximately Rs 34.83 crore. That’s how it is for now. And surely, that alone is enough to demonstrate the significance of dividends in his earnings. Adding more to that, well, yes, beside that, he also generates profits through Catamaran Ventures.
Total Assets & Investments
The major piece of his fortune is still his shareholding in Infosys if we are talking about his assets. That is the basis of his entire wealth. Secondly, Catamaran Ventures is his primary investment vehicle. However, besides that, there have been some older investments like SKS Microfinance appearing in public records. On the personal front, he has premium properties in Bengaluru. For example, in 2024, it was reported that he purchased a luxury flat at Kingfisher Towers for around Rs 50 crore, you must have heard that in the headlines at some point, right?
